Miniature UNSC Marines and Covenant aliens in the Halo Interactive Strategy Board Game
There may be some hope for Halo fans who are waiting for their Xbox 360s afflicted with the Red Ring of Death. Genius Products and B1 Games are going to be releasing a Halo Interactive Strategy Board Game. In September 2008, players will be able to face off against one… Continue Reading »

Cranium coming to the Wii
Straight from the match made in heaven department, Ubisoft has announced it will be bringing a console version of popular board game Cranium to the Wii this December. Cranium Kabookii will feature classic Cranium gameplay while making copious use of the WiiMote and special glasses (allowing the player to read… Continue Reading »
